"Isidoro cured me of cancer"
In 1961, Fr. Joseph Escribano, then living in Canada, developed a mass between his lungs that showed signs of cancer. People around him prayed for his cure through Isidoro's intercession. When the doctors operated on him to remove that mass and get a more accurate diagnosis, they found no traces of it.
Anniversary Mass of St Josemaria in Kuala Lumpur
For the second consecutive year in over 30 years, the Anniversary Mass of St Josemaria was held in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ia on July 6, 2019. His Grace, Archbishop Julien Leow celebrated the Mass in honour of St Josemaria at St John's Cathedral in Kuala Lumpur, capital of Malaysia.

Renewing the Enthusiasm of a Tired World
The University of Navarra awarded honorary doctorates this year to British sociologist Margaret S. Archer; Israeli philologist Ruth Fine; American writer and media expert Robert Picard; and Spanish architect Rafael Moneo.
